The president of the Council of Ministers, Alberto Otarolareported this morning that next year it is planned increase the number of supervisions by the Energy and Mining Investment Supervisory Body to companies in the sector.
Thus, he explained that in 2024 the goal of said organization is to achieve more than 200,000 supervisions of energy and mining operators, which represents almost an additional 60% compared to what was registered last year.
“Likewise, it is planned to provide nearly 427,000 guidelines to the public through the various service channels that the entity has made available. This figure represents an additional 18% by 2022,” added the prime minister during his participation in the Commission. Congressional Budget.
Greater budget for Devida
In the field of the fight against drug trafficking, Otárola explained that in 2024 the budget of the National Commission for Development and Life without Drugs (Devida) will be increased for comprehensive and sustainable alternative development, with the aim of providing technical assistance to communities and families to diversify production and reduce the presence of illegal coca crops.
“We plan to provide technical assistance to more than 46,000 families in terms of productive diversification, in order to strengthen the value chain of licit alternative products and this will mean 27,000 families assisted in direct execution and nearly 20,000 families through financial transfers in investment,” he commented.
The PCM also plans to strengthen psychological counseling, increase the eradication of illegal coca crops, and carry out supervision of forestry concessions and authorizations.
Training for public servants
In terms of public management, it is planned to train more than 57,000 civil servants through the National School of Public Administration of the National Civil Service Authority (Servir) to promote performance and management in public entities. This represents 97% more than this year’s goal.
The performance management and training management process will also be promoted in 21% of public entities.
What other goals does the PCM have planned?
Below are other points explained by the prime minister:
- Intervention in dialogue tables: The PCM plans to intervene in 2,000 dialogue tables in 2024. This initiative aims to promote frank and open dialogue with the authorities and organized civil society in relation to the territorial development of the country and address 83% of related early warnings with social conflicts.
- Prospective studies: 17 prospective studies will be carried out that will analyze the behavior of specific variables over time in areas such as climate change, health, education, water, sanitation and security. These analyzes will allow the design of public policies and long-term strategic plans.
- Technical assistance: 2,000 continuous technical assistance will be provided in the plans of the three levels of government, within the framework of the Strategic Plan for National Development to 2050.
- Promotion and regulation of competitive markets: Indecopi will provide 452,000 guidelines on consumer protection and will address 92,000 complaints related to deceptive practices and unsatisfactory services.
- Technological development and innovation strategies: Grants will be awarded for research, technological development and innovation projects in areas such as climate change, biodiversity, health, food security, renewable energy and information technologies.
- Budget Execution: The improvement in budget execution of the PCM sector in recent years was highlighted, with a projection of 98% for the current year.
